- W4386805376 abstract "MgF2 film was usually created on magnesium (Mg) alloys to enhance its corrosion resistance and biocompatibility. Nonetheless, MgF2 film was mainly created by immersion of Mg alloys in highly toxic HF solution. In the current work, a potassium magnesium fluoride (KMgF3) film was fabricated on AZ31 Mg alloy through immersion of the MgF2 coated alloy in 1 mol·dm−3 KF solution. The surface/cross-section morphologies and structure of the KMgF3 film coated alloy before and after corrosion were examined. The corrosion resistance, surface properties and biocompatibility of the KMgF3 film coated AZ31 Mg alloy were characterized as well. The results showed that a compact monolayer film consisting of KMgF3 as the major phase and MgF2 and MgO as the minor phases was formed on AZ31 Mg alloy. The KMgF3 film coated alloy showed a reduction in the evolved hydrogen volume by 68% and a corrosion current density by around 49 times as compared to AZ31 Mg alloy. Additionally, The KMgF3 film coated alloy exhibited a better long-term durability in simulated body fluid than the MgF2 coated Mg alloy. Moreover, the KMgF3 film improved the hydrophilicity of AZ31 Mg alloy and stimulated the proliferation of bone marrow mesenchymal stem cells." @default.
